薬剤耐性てんかんの世界市場規模は2024年に18億5,000万米ドル、2030年には24億4,000万米ドルに達すると予測され、予測期間中の年間平均成長率(CAGR)は4.72%を記録します。

同市場は、従来の抗てんかん薬(AED)では十分な効果が得られない患者のアンメットニーズへの対応に焦点を当てた強力な研究開発活動により、進化を続けています。

てんかんは、発作の再発を特徴とする神経疾患で、世界的に多くの患者が罹患しています。薬剤耐性てんかん-難治性てんかんとも呼ばれる-は、2種類以上の適切なAEDによる治療にもかかわらず発作が続く症例を指します。難治性てんかんはアンメット・メディカル・ニーズの高い疾患であり、世界の市場において技術革新と投資が進んでいます。

Epilepsy, a neurological condition characterized by recurrent seizures, affects a significant global population. Drug-resistant epilepsy-also known as refractory epilepsy-refers to cases in which patients continue to experience seizures despite treatment with two or more appropriate AEDs. This segment represents a substantial unmet clinical need, propelling innovation and investment across the global market landscape.

Key Market Drivers

Increasing Prevalence of Epilepsy

The rising global incidence of epilepsy is a primary factor fueling market growth. According to the World Health Organization (WHO), approximately 50 million individuals worldwide are affected by epilepsy. Of this population, an estimated 30% do not respond adequately to standard anti-seizure therapies, resulting in drug-resistant forms of the disorder.

As global demographics shift toward an aging population, the overall prevalence of epilepsy is expected to rise, contributing to an increased burden of drug-resistant cases. This trend underscores the urgent need for advanced therapeutic solutions tailored to this difficult-to-treat patient group.

Additionally, while up to 70% of epilepsy patients could potentially achieve seizure control with appropriate treatment, approximately 75% of individuals in low-income regions lack access to essential medications. This treatment gap highlights the critical importance of early diagnosis, improved access to care, and continued innovation in therapeutic options designed specifically for drug-resistant epilepsy.

Key Market Challenges

Complex and Heterogeneous Disease Profile

One of the most significant challenges in treating drug-resistant epilepsy is the condition's complex and heterogeneous nature. The disorder comprises a wide range of seizure types, each with distinct etiologies, clinical presentations, and treatment responses. This variability complicates efforts to develop universally effective therapies.

The evolving nature of drug-resistant epilepsy further contributes to its clinical complexity. Seizure patterns and drug efficacy may change over time, requiring continuous reassessment and adaptation of treatment strategies. As a result, the development of standardized interventions remains a major hurdle, necessitating a more personalized approach to care.

Key Market Trends

Advancements in Neuroimaging Technologies

Innovations in neuroimaging are significantly enhancing diagnostic and therapeutic capabilities in the drug-resistant epilepsy market. These advanced imaging techniques are transforming clinical approaches by providing deeper insights into brain structure and function.

Modern Magnetic Resonance Imaging (MRI) technologies-including functional MRI (fMRI), diffusion tensor imaging (DTI), and magnetic resonance spectroscopy (MRS)-offer high-resolution views of brain activity, connectivity, and subtle structural abnormalities. These tools are instrumental in identifying epileptic foci and guiding surgical or targeted treatment options.

Positron Emission Tomography (PET) also plays a crucial role by detecting metabolic irregularities in brain regions associated with seizure activity. Enhanced by advanced radiotracers and image processing methods, PET imaging facilitates more accurate diagnosis and localization of epileptic zones.

In addition, Single-Photon Emission Computed Tomography (SPECT) is widely used to assess cerebral blood flow during seizures, helping clinicians pinpoint seizure origins and inform personalized treatment planning. Collectively, these advancements are fostering a more precise and effective management paradigm for drug-resistant epilepsy.
